Transaction ab0f3072c27317d4d4ae154d89c01fff92fe711ec798a89254c780c7338d2822
1 Input
1 Output
-
ab0f3072c27317d4d4ae154d89c01fff92fe711ec798a89254c780c7338d2822:0
- value
- 18252341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0abb8e58c5608ed249300394fcea02451c0ec450 OP_EQUAL
- address
- M8sufyFsA6sCgUGNwC4vPAf4swWUhNgkhW